### Off-site run — Film reels for the Gildercroft Archive

- Collect the six nitrate-era reels from the Moxley screening room; they're in the grey climate cases, already strapped.
- Keep them upright and out of direct sun — seriously, no leaving the van parked in the open.
- Confirm the case count against the manifest before you leave and again on arrival.
- Archive intake closes at 3pm, so don't dawdle. The courier hand-over instruction is below.

handover note for yagef-bagep: the drudor pelius courier leaves the kasdor zorvan norir ledger at gate 8016 under passcode 755406

Over the past two quarters, exceptions ran at 31% of qualifying deals, eroding blended margin by roughly two points. I've drafted a tightened framework: hard floor at 15%, exception committee monthly, and claw-back clauses on multi-year terms. Berrin Saltmarsh assumes ownership effective next week; transition notes are filed in the Greyfen repository. The confidential business-plan note follows below.

confidential, bahap-bajog: Zorethix Works is in early talks to buy Kelethox Foods for about $30.7 million. The Ralvan launch date is September 19, and nothing goes to the press before then.

Memo — Loyalty Programme Overhaul

Welcome aboard! Quick heads-up: the old Pennywheel points scheme at Marlowe & Finch is getting a full rebuild this quarter. Tiers shrink from five to three, and redemption moves in-app. Expect some grumbling from long-time members. Full deck is on the shared drive. One more thing, for your eyes only.

board note of fahap-yafop: Headcount on the Istion team goes from 50 to 73 by the end of September. Gross margin on Istion came in at 33 percent against a plan of 28 percent.

MEMO — Falconet Drone Return

Hi Mira,

The Falconet X2 we lent to the Breyhaven survey team came back with a wobbly gimbal, so it's heading to Aerlume Servicing this week. I've already boxed it with the spare props and the battery in the fire pouch — please don't open it again, the foam took me ages. Carrier is Swiftmere Couriers, pickup window Tuesday 10–12. Just make sure the service form is taped to the outside and the box stays in the locked cage until then.

handover note for tadug-yaguf: the aldath pelwyn courier leaves the casox norwyn briix silok zorok kasdor aldion quenox ledger at gate 2653 under passcode 959015